    2. Red Rocks Park and Amphitheatre - Overview: An iconic geological wonder, Red Rocks Park not only boasts naturally formed amphitheaters but also provides stunning trails for hiking and biking. The park’s unique red sandstone formations create a dramatic backdrop for concerts and events. Take a morning hike on the Trading Post Trail, then explore the Visitor Center to learn about the geology and history. Boulder and the Flatirons - Overview: Boulder, a charming college town nestled against the Flatirons rock formations, invites visitors to stroll along Pearl Street Mall, lined with boutique shops, cafes, and street performers. Hike the Chautauqua Trailhead for breathtaking views of the city and beyond, or relax at Boulder Creek Path for a more tranquil experience. Golden and Coors Brewery Tour - Overview: Travel back in time to Golden, Colorado's first capital, where you can tour the historic Coors Brewery, one of the world's largest single-site breweries. After the tour, wander through the charming streets, visiting the Buffalo Bill Museum and Grave, or enjoy a paddle on Clear Creek.
